Summary:The aim of this study is to discover the mathematical aspect that found in Sasak tribe as shown by the architecture, customs and culture that define Sasak tribe. This study was conducted using ethnographic studies and descriptive qualitative analysis. This study focuses both tangible and intangible aspects of sasak tribe culture which represent sasaknese characteristics. Data was collected using interviews, observations and documentation techniques. The data analysis methodology was conducted utilizing a triangulation method in which specialists and researchers crossed each other in order to look further into the cultural presence of mathematics in society. This study concludes that there is an element of mathematics in the culture of the Sasak tribe, seen from the buildings that have spatial and flat shapes. Other cultures include broad calculations and habits that are integrated with the life of the Sasak people.
